  • Unmarried Sister-in-Law applying for visa - please help!!

    Hi gurus,

    My unmarried sister-in-law (age 23) wants to visit us for a couple of months in the US.
    She had a job in the IT sector but got recently laid off. She's got a good bank balance.
    My mother-in-law is currently in the US on a visitor visa and is slated to go back November end.
    My father-in-law also has his visa approved but he is still back in India.

    Now I know its hard to get visa for unmarried single girls but I have been hearing about
    visas getting approved for single guys & students etc recently, especially due to swine flu
    and economic recession in the US, so US govt wants more tourists and students.

    What are the chances for my sister-in-law? Does it help to emphasize that she has marriage plans
    upon return? Would a rejection hurt her chances for a future US student visa? (she has plans to
    apply for MS later)

    Appreciate any help on this!

  • #2
    23 years old single girl with no job. That is very low possibility of getting visa.

    Tourist visa rejection generally does not affect future student visa.
